Selected challenges in low-energy QCD and hadron physics

Abstract

This presentation briefly addresses three basic issues of low-energy QCD: first, whether the Nambu-Goldstone scenario of spontaneous chiral symmetry breaking is well established_s19 secondly, whether there is a dynamical entanglement of the chiral and deconfinement crossover transitions in QCD_s19 and thirdly, what is the status of knowledge about the phase diagram of QCD at low temperature and non-zero baryon density. These three topics were injected as key words into a panel discussion at the Schladming school on Challenges in QCD. The following exposition reflects the style and character of the discussions, with no claim of completeness.
